28
What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d [email protected]

What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d [email protected]

Embed Size (px)

Citation preview

Page 1: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

What is

intraLibrary

Connect?

Martin Morrey

Product Director, Intrallect Ltd

[email protected]

Page 2: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

Why connect?

Page 3: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

In the Institution

Portal

RAE team CLA Reports OPAC Projects

HandheldsWikis, BlogsVLE/LMS

ePrints Images

eLearningScanned material

RAE outputsExam

papers

audio

video

Page 4: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com
Page 5: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

Choice 1: System

Interoperability

LMS

Library

System

LOR

URL

SRU

IMS

CP

SRU

OAI-PMH

Standards-based integration

Page 6: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

Choice 2: System

Integration

LMS

Library

System

LOR

Custom integration

Page 7: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

Which services?

Page 8: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com
Page 9: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com
Page 10: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com
Page 11: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

What is

intraLibrary?

Page 12: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

IntraLibary Architecture• Pure J2EE – Java Enterprise (platform independent)

• 3-tier architecture, applying MVC pattern

• Web-centric

SQL database

User Interface

(AJAX)

Web Services

(Connect)

Custom Integration

Java API

Business Logic

Object-Relational Mapping (ORM) Data Access Objects (DAO)

Page 13: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

How has it evolved?

Page 14: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

intraLibrary 2.4 (Oct 2005)

Library

System

LOR

intraLibraryIMS MD

IEEE LOM

ODRL

OAI PMH

Authoring

Tool

IMS CP

SCORM

User

IDsUser

IDsUser

Info

LDAP…

WWW

URLVLE

LMS

Java API:• integration• management

Page 15: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

intraLibrary 2.8

Library

System

LOR

intraLibraryIMS MD

IEEE LOM

ODRL

SRU/SRW

OAI PMH

Authoring

Tool

IMS CP

SCORM

User

IDsUser

IDsUser

Info

LDAP…

WWW

URLVLE

LMS

Java API:• integration• management• deposit

RSS

Page 16: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

intraLibrary 2.9

Library

System

LOR

intraLibraryIMS MD

IEEE LOM

ODRL

SRU/SRW

OAI PMH

Authoring

Tool

IMS CP

SCORM

User

IDsUser

IDsUser

Info

LDAP…

WWW

URLVLE

LMS

Java API:• integration• management• deposit• events/logging

RSS

Page 17: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

intraLibrary 3.0

Library

System

LOR

intraLibraryIMS MD

IEEE LOM

ODRL

SRU/SRW

OAI PMH

Authoring

Tool

IMS CP

SCORM

User

IDsUser

IDsUser

Info

LDAP…

WWW

URLVLE

LMS

Java API:• integration• management• deposit• events/logging• data access

RSS

Podcast

Legacy

Blogging

Clients etc SWORDAPP

Page 18: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

What's new?

Page 19: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

SWORD• Simple Web-Service Ordering Repository

Deposit

• Enables automated deposit of packaged

content, files or records

• Supports integration with desktop clients,

bulk transfer between systems

(SOURCE), custom solutions for legacy

materials

• Profile of the Atom Publishing Protocol

Page 20: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

LMS Plugins

• Enable search and linking from within

the LMS

• Use SRU interface

• Blackboard Vista (WebCT)

• Moodle

• Blackboard Enterprise

Page 21: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

Podcast

• Enabled automated download of

materials that match specific critieria

• Repository becomes an end-to-end

solution for storing, managing and

exposing audio, video, images etc for

students

Page 22: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

Where is it going?

Page 23: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

Networked RepositoryMetadata Harvesting• OAI-PMH Repository*• OAI-PMH Harvester

•Federated Search:• SRU/SRW*

More targeted

searching• Access4All• QTI Metadata

*available

Content as a service•OpenURL

Page 24: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

IMS LODE

• Well defined profiles of:

– SRU & CQL

– OAI-PMH

– OpenURL?

• Test suite

• Sample implementations

• LMS support?

Page 25: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

SWORD 2

• Covering more (all?) of the APP

• Support update and delete operations

• Expose the structure of the complex

objects

Page 26: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

Complex Objects

Object Resources File 1

File 2...

File N

Object

Item 1

Item 2...

Item N

Views

View 1

View 2...

View N

Item 1.1

Item 1.2...

Item 1.N

Resource 1

Resource 2...

Resource N

Page 27: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

SWORD 2

• Covering more (all?) of the APP

• Support update and delete operations

• Expose the structure of the complex

objects

– taking into account OAI-ORE

– independent of packaging format

• IMS CP

• METS

• MPEG DIDL

Page 28: What is intraLibrary Connect? Martin Morrey Product Director, Intrallect Ltd M.Morrey@intrallect.com

intraLibrary Connect